I believe education is very important and it can help people achieve their goals and dreams. That’s why I decided to continue my education at MAIA Impact School, part of the Women’s Opportunity Alliance Network. The school provides education for indigenous girls from rural areas like mine. In Guatemala, less than 20% of indigenous girls graduate from high school. MAIA helped me finish my studies and graduate. Going there was the best decision I’ve ever made.
